Ethereum: where do the timestamps on blocks come from?
The mysterious origin of Ethereum blocks: Disassembly of a mystery
In the world of Blockchain technology, the basic aspect of its operation is often overlooked -the origin of the Block -Time Seams. As we investigate the internal operation of Ethereum and other decentralized systems, it becomes clear that the timestamps indicated in the blocks are not as straightforward as they look.
Lack of global clock: first step
The concept of the lack of a global clock in Blockchain systems dates back to the original Bitcoin model of Satoshi Nakamoto. In Bitcoin, each block is given a unique identifier called “block hash” or “hash”, which serves as a time stamp in that block.
However, in the case of Ethereum, the situation becomes more complicated. Unlike Bitcoin, where each event creates a new block with a separate timestamp, the Blockchain system of Ethereum depends on the older design known as “work certificate”. In this model, miners compete to solve a complex mathematical puzzle that requires significant computational force and energy.
The role of time -stamped algorithms
To facilitate the creation of blocks, the algorithm of the timestamp is used at regular intervals. This algorithm gives timing to each block by decentralizing the previous block with Hash’s current timestamp. The resulting Hash acts as a timestamp of that block.
One possible explanation of how these time stamps are created is the way the Blockchain system uses encryption technology to validate events. In particular, the Sha-256 (protected hash-algorithm 256) algorithm used in Ethereum is designed to produce a fixed length based on a certain incomes. In this case, the feed is a timestamp that acts as seeds for Hash.
Haikara brings them … or not?
When trying to explain how the block -time stamps are created without relying on complex algorithms, it can be suggested that the stork brings them … or not? This reasoning simplifies the problem.
The truth is that the algorithm of the Ethereum timestamp is designed in the mind of a particular architecture. The algorithm uses a combination of mathematical constants and hash functions to produce the desired departures. In other words, it does not just “bring” time stamps to existence; Rather, it produces them through a carefully designed process.
conclusion
In summary, the origins of Ethereum block seams are rooted in the design principles of work certificate block chain systems. Although it may seem like a reply, the algorithm used to create these timestamps is not just a random or random determination. Instead, it is a carefully designed system that utilizes encryption factors and mathematical constants to produce a reliable and predictable output.
As we continue to study the internal operation of Ethereum and other decentralized systems, it becomes more and more clear that understanding the complexity of their architecture is essential for the construction of solid and safe applications over these networks.